Preston's Summary

Jillian Ambrose is an Energy Correspondent at The Guardian. She covers a wide range of topics related to energy, including clean energy, fossil fuels, and the climate crisis, with a focus on energy policy, sustainability, and regulation. Jillian's work has been featured in prominent outlets such as Grist, EURACTIV, and Mother Jones, among others.

Pitching Insights

Jillian Ambrose's coverage largely focuses on energy-related topics, with a significant emphasis on government announcements and citations of data. This indicates that she prefers fact-based reporting and is likely to be interested in pitches backed by credible data and research.

Given her focus on government announcements, she may respond well to expert commentary or insights related to policy changes within the energy sector, as well as industry-specific trends supported by reliable data sources.

The geographic focus for Jillian's articles appears to be centered around the UK due to the nature of some article titles referencing local developments. Therefore, relevant pitches should consider this regional context when offering insights or expertise related to energy policies and developments.
